Yes, Ice Dancing has evolved like all sports. However, some techniques have not changed. For example, pushing into the ice, leading with the knee very bent, pushing to the side and not
back, etc. remain as crucial elements to make one look like a dancer. Sorry the cha-cha is not in the book...it was not a USFS dance when the book was published.
I wrote the book to preserve the information of my coach, Jean Westwood the first world ice dance champion, and her coach Gladys Hogg both of whom produced many champions.
Compulsory ice dances are fading on the competitive scene so this information is important as young skaters will not be learning these compulsories and so who is to teach them in the future.
